Question :
Comment puis-je utiliser le flux de travail pour déterminer le nombre le plus bas dans un champ de mot-clé ou de tableau ?
Réponse :
Comment puis-je utiliser le flux de travail pour déterminer le nombre le plus bas dans un champ de mot-clé ou de tableau ?
Réponse :
Veuillez consulter la démonstration suivante pour savoir comment déterminer la valeur la plus basse contenue dans un champ de mot-clé.
Les champs de table étant constitués de mots-clés, cette démonstration s'applique également à ces champs.
Les champs de table étant constitués de mots-clés, cette démonstration s'applique également à ces champs.
L'image suivante représente l'ensemble du flux de travail et devrait servir de modèle pour la mise en place de ce processus.
1. Initialiser les variables
Les quatre variables globales suivantes devront être créées et initialisées dans une activité d'affectation de données au cours de cette étape. Chaque variable devra être créée en tant que type de données Integer.
Les quatre variables globales suivantes devront être créées et initialisées dans une activité d'affectation de données au cours de cette étape. Chaque variable devra être créée en tant que type de données Integer.
Compteur = Entrée fixe de 0
TotalItems = Expression arithmétique de COUNT (champ de mots clés)
CurrentNumber = Expression arithmétique de cInt(Keyword Field[GV_counter])
Le plus bas = Variable globale CurrentNumber
Le plus bas = Variable globale CurrentNumber
2. Obtenir le numéro courant
Dans cette étape, créez une autre activité d'affectation de données dans laquelle nous devons redéfinir l'élément courant de la liste à l'aide de l'affectation suivante ;
CurrentNumber = Expression arithmétique de cInt(Champ de mots-clés [GV_counter])
3. Vérifier le nombre le plus bas
Créer une activité Condition. Au cours de l'étape Condition, nous vérifions maintenant si notre nombre actuel est inférieur à notre variable Lowest actuellement définie.
Créer une activité Condition. Au cours de l'étape Condition, nous vérifions maintenant si notre nombre actuel est inférieur à notre variable Lowest actuellement définie.
Si c'est le cas, nous mettrons à jour la variable Lowest, sinon nous passerons à la vérification de la fin de la liste. Définissez la condition comme suit :
GV_CurrentNumber< GV_Lowest
Condition remplie : Alors
Condition non remplie : Else
GV_CurrentNumber< GV_Lowest
Condition remplie : Alors
Condition non remplie : Else
4. Mise à jour du nombre le plus bas
Si notre nombre actuel est plus bas, nous mettrons à jour la variable la plus basse avec ce qui suit,
Plus bas = Variable globale du nombre actuel
5. Vérifier si à la fin de la liste
Ici, nous allons vérifier la variable TotalItem pour déterminer s'il nous reste des éléments à traiter.
Si c'est le cas, nous incrémenterons le compteur, puis nous exécuterons à nouveau les étapes ci-dessus. Sinon, nous quitterons le flux de travail. Remplissez la condition comme suit ;
Ici, nous allons vérifier la variable TotalItem pour déterminer s'il nous reste des éléments à traiter.
Si c'est le cas, nous incrémenterons le compteur, puis nous exécuterons à nouveau les étapes ci-dessus. Sinon, nous quitterons le flux de travail. Remplissez la condition comme suit ;
GV_Counter >= GV_TotalItems - 1
Condition remplie : Alors
Condition non remplie : Sinon
Condition remplie : Alors
Condition non remplie : Sinon
6. Incrémenter le compteur
Si nous avons plus de données à traiter, cette étape d'affectation des données incrémentera le compteur de 1.
Compteur = Expression arithmétique de GV_Counter + 1
7. Si vous n'avez rien d'autre à ajouter, quittez le flux de travail.
KBAs'applique aussi bien aux organisations en nuage qu'aux organisations sur site.
KBAs'applique aussi bien aux organisations en nuage qu'aux organisations sur site.
Veuillez noter : Cet article est une traduction de l'anglais. Les informations contenues dans cet article sont basées sur la ou les versions originales des produits en langue anglaise. Il peut y avoir des erreurs mineures, notamment dans la grammaire utilisée dans la version traduite de nos articles. Bien que nous ne puissions pas garantir l'exactitude complète de la traduction, dans la plupart des cas, vous la trouverez suffisamment informative. En cas de doute, veuillez revenir à la version anglaise de cet article.